BASELWORLD Your questions answered Mar 26, 2009 - 02:37 PM

Hi All;

I went through all your questions and chose 10 to ask the nice folks at Rolex during my meeting this afternoon. If your question wasn't chosen, don't take it as any insult; I picked the questions that I thought would be most interesting to everyone. As TZ is a worldwide site, I didn't pick any nation specific questions such as how much a particular model might cost in a particular country, nor did I pick any question that could be seen as either insulting or accusatory. With all that out of the way; here we go:

1 When will be see a Pepsi/Coke bezel on the GMT IIC?
Not any time soon, there are still problems with the red ceramic. In a meeting earlier today with another brand who have ceramic dials they mentioned that the failure rate with red enamel was around 95%; higher then with any other colour because red enamel/ceramic needs to be fired many more times than other colours. Remember Rolex need a product that can be replicated many thousands of times, not one that is handmade one at a time.

2 Will the new Datejust II get the domed bezel?
No, as the new case is much more rounded than the previous one, with no edges on the case top, adding a domed bezel would make the watch look too rounded. However there is a possibility that a flat bevelled bezel (like the Milgauss one) might be fitted.

3 What changes have been made to the movements in the new DJ II?
As expected, the Parachrom hairspring and Parachoc shock absorber have been added, but the main change is that the date wheel is now positioned further out from the movement, because the date window is now further from the centre wheel. This modification means that this movement gets a new model number; the 3136.

4 Will the DJ II get the Jubilee bracelet?
Soon

5 Will the 36mm Datejust be discontinued?
No

6 Will there be other Sports Models made in Everose gold?
No comment

7 Will there be increased distribution of Tudor models?
Yes, Rolex will be re-introducing the brand in all markets, but this may take a few years as they want to bring up production slowly; so as not to impact the quality.

8 Will Rolex introduce AR coatings on the glass?
No, except on the cyclops; if AR coating is used the glass essentially disappears, this is not something Rolex wish to do. In all Rolex watches the glass is an integral part of the design of the watch, which is why it sits above the bezel.

9 Will the Yachtmaster II be available in steel?
No comment, but not a definite 'No'

10 When will the No Date Submariner get the updated bracelet?
No comment.

I know that some of the answers may not be the ones you wanted to hear; but I am just the messenger.
